Shadowfax IPO to Open on January 22, Offering Investors a Play on India’s Logistics Boom

Shadowfax is set to enter the capital markets with its initial public offering opening on January 22, marking a significant milestone for India’s fast-evolving logistics and last-mile delivery sector. The IPO aims to raise capital to strengthen the company’s balance sheet, expand operational capabilities, and support long-term growth initiatives. Backed by rising e-commerce penetration and increasing demand for efficient supply-chain solutions, Shadowfax’s public issue has drawn attention from both institutional and retail investors.

Shadowfax IPO Set to Open Next Week, Targets Rs 7,400 Crore Valuation

Shadowfax, one of India’s leading logistics and supply chain platforms, is set to launch its initial public offering (IPO) next week, with the company targeting a valuation of approximately Rs 7,400 crore. The IPO is expected to attract significant investor interest due to Shadowfax’s extensive delivery network, technology-driven logistics solutions, and strong revenue growth. Analysts note that the listing could provide liquidity for early investors and enable the company to fund expansion into new geographies and service offerings.

Shadowfax Targets Rs 2,500 Crore IPO via Confidential Route, Valuation Sees 40% Surge

Logistics startup Shadowfax is preparing to file its draft IPO papers confidentially with SEBI within the next month, signalling its ambition to raise between Rs. 2,000–2,500 crore at an estimated valuation of Rs. 5,500–6,000 crore. Targeting growth in its emerging quick commerce and hyperlocal delivery verticals, the company plans to allocate approximately Rs. 1,000–1,100 crore of fresh capital towards scaling these services.
